Description

The Ultimate Member WordPress plugin before 2.13.0 does not check whether a comment has been approved, or whether the profile it belongs to is private, before returning profile activity to unauthenticated visitors, allowing them to read the content of comments still awaiting moderation.

Executive Summary

This vulnerability affects the Ultimate Member WordPress plugin versions before 2.13.0. It allows unauthenticated users to view unapproved comments on user profiles because the plugin fails to check if comments are approved or if the profile is private before showing profile activity. This exposes moderation-pending comment content to unauthorized visitors.

Detection Guidance

Check if the Ultimate Member plugin version is below 2.13.0 by inspecting the plugin files or WordPress admin panel. Look for unapproved comments on user profiles that may be visible to unauthenticated users.

Mitigation Strategies

Update the Ultimate Member plugin to version 2.13.0 or later immediately. If updating is not possible, consider temporarily disabling the plugin until the update can be applied.
